The Dallas Cowboys needed to beat a game New England Patriots thanks to the cooking area sink tossed at them by masterful head coach Expense Belichick, but left with a thrilling 35-29 triumph. The game's energy swung numerous times over the last quarter as well as into overtime, yet the initial significant barrage was special and also all-too-familiar at the very same time. With Dallas tracking as well as points looking grim, there was cornerback Trevon Diggs intercepting a pass for the sixth-straight game.

On his 7th interception of the young season, linking a mark established by then-DPOY Rod Woodson in 1993, Diggs damaged on a Mac Jones pass for Kendrick Bourne and when the pass receiver was not able to corral it, Diggs had the ability to. And afterwards, like he did a couple of weeks earlier, Diggs housed it.

Diggs is the initial player in franchise background with an interception in six-straight competitions to begin a period and he tied the NFL document initially set by Tom Landry in 1951 and also tied two times considering that. Yes, that Tom Landry.
